Cloud applications are usually developed towards a remote API that is individually managed by a third party, typically the cloud provider. Instigated by changes, such as pricing, porting an application from consuming some API endpoints to another typically requires a fair degree of re-engineering especially since even syn¬tactically similar APIs could digress semantically. As a result, the enhancing realisation in the inevitability involving cross-cloud computer led to numerous pro¬posed alternatives. As expected having such a nascent field, there is also a certain degree of confusion arising from the use of non-convergent terminology: cross types clouds, multi¬clouds, meta-cloud, federated clouds, and so forth The first con¬tribution of this documents, thus, is usually to offer a coherent un¬derstanding involving cross-cloud computer. The second share is a category based on the termi¬nology witnessed so far in this discipline along with promi¬nent efforts of each, describing his or her modus operandi and activities on their appropriateness and limits, and how these people relate to the responsibility of different stakeholders. The third and even fourth benefits are a review of current difficulties and a outlook about research opportuni¬ties, respectively. These types of contributions are usually targeted towards mapping the forthcoming focus of cloud specialists, specifically application builders and research workers.
Precisely why cross fog up boundaries?
Some sort of cross-cloud app is one that consumes multiple cloud API under a solo version on the appli¬cation. Let us consider a handful of examples sucked from real cases where builders are confronted with the option to use different APIs, i. vitamin e. to fold cloud limitations.
- Alan, an online company, finds of which his user base is more fleeting than he planned designed for: web stats indicates which a large ratio of users are being able to access services by way of mobile devices and later for a few a matter of minutes (as in opposition to hours since Alan initially envisioned). Joe decides to alter how this individual manages his / her service facilities using impetuous virtual equipment (VMs) instead of dedicated long lastting ones. This individual, thus, alterations his busi¬ness plan to use a different CSP that expenses by the tracfone unit rather than the hour, saving him hun¬dreds regarding dollars each month in detailed expenses.
- A company is usually consolidating some of its inner teams and even, accordingly, their particular respective solutions will be single into a single platform. Bella, the particular company’s Main Information Expert (CIO), looks after this task. The girl objective is usually to keep most of in¬ternal products operational as frictionless to use as possible during and after the particular transition. Bella finds the fact that the teams being consolidated happen to be us¬ing distinctive public and private cloud infrastructures for different operations strong within their design. This requires major changes to the underlying logic that handles task software, service provisi¬oning, resource operations, etc.
- An online video games startup Casus is speedily expand¬ing its user base. Typically the cloud allows Casus in order to con¬sume a growing amount of sources as and when necessary, which is extremely advantageous. However , the impair does not necessarily aid in pro¬viding an optimized service to consumers who are not really rel¬atively near any impair datacenters, for example those within the Arabian Gulf of mexico region, west Africa, or cen¬tral Asian countries. In order to focus on such users, Casus must use innovative techniques to manage high qual¬ity of encounter. One such strategy is to improve the housing of common sense and information beyond a CSP, but instead to be able to relocate on de¬mand to regional CSPs although maintaining service plan op¬eration along the different facilities substrata.
A common line to these scenarios is change to the predetermined plan relating to service provisioning, use, or even management. Different parts of the application (virtu¬alized infrastructure administrator, load dénoncer, etc . ) would need to be changed to phone different APIs. Change is, of course , element of business. Hence, the need for cross¬cloud systems normally grows better as industries and societies increasingly make use of cloud. Such change, how¬ever, entails basic changes to typically the communication actions to accommodate several semantics, getting models, and SLA conditions. This is the central cross-cloud problem. Another commonality is the ought to be free from long¬term commitment. Countless consumers opt for the cloud designed for agility and even elasticity. In the past few years, this was re¬stricted to the limitations of a individual CSP nevertheless currently the craze is to surpasse different CSPs. A recent sur¬vey discovered that typically the “ability to advance data from a service to another” ranked very highly like a concern raised by individual sector SMEs as well as huge organisa¬tions involving the cloud. As such, numerous works inside academia plus industry currently have attempted to deal with this concern using unique strategies. Before trying to rank these functions, it is perhaps important to explain the obvious: This is simply not a thesis for a globally uniform provisioning sys¬tem. To start with, such “uber cloud” is unrealistic offered the commercial nature from the market. Second, we believe that to be nutritious to have a different cloud market where every single provider brings a unique mixture of specialized products and services that provides a certain niche market of the marketplace.
More Information regarding Over the internet Info Cutting find below www.innsite.es .